Java FullStack Lead

3 weeks ago


Princeton, United States Ness Digital Engineering Full time

Ness is a full lifecycle digital engineering firm offering digital advisory through scaled engineering services. Combining our core competence in engineering with the latest in digital strategy and technology, we seamlessly manage Digital Transformation journeys from strategy through execution to help businesses thrive in the digital economy. As your tech partner, we help engineer your company’s future with cloud and data. For more information, visit www.ness.com


Job Title: Java Full Stack Lead (React tools exp is mandatory)

Location: Princeton, NJ (Hybrid Day 1)


Note: Position is Contract to hire with end customer (after 6 months)


As an Engineering Lead for the application delivery team, you will be responsible for leading a talented team of engineers (DEV&QA). You will demonstrate high technical acumen, solution design capability, and strong hands-on expertise in the development of technical solutions for complex business requirements. You will play leading role in providing the technical guidance to the team, best practices adoption, fostering collaborative & dynamic team built-up ensuring successful development and delivery of high-quality enterprise applications/systems.


Core Responsibilities (Team & Delivery Leadership):

Technical Acumen:

  • Deliver business value through application development and enhancements.
  • Demonstrate a strong sense of ownership and responsibility with assignments. This includes gathering and understanding requirements, technical specifications, design, architecture, implementation, unit testing, builds/deployments, and code management.
  • Evaluate, assess, plan, and guide technical direction and architecture decisions.


Leading Team:

  • Mentor, guide the development team through the process of design, estimation, development, and unit testing.
  • Conduct code reviews, ensure coding standards are maintained, lead the best practices adoption, and drive continuous improvement in development processes.
  • Lead to inspire a team of engineers, fostering a positive and productive work culture.
  • Be a self-starter and an excellent team player.
  • Stay abreast with industry trends and technological advancements and apply this knowledge to guide the team in selecting appropriate technologies and methodologies.
  • Provide technical guidance, support professional development, and conduct regular performance reviews in conjunction to the delivery managers.


Partnership:

  • Interface, collaborate and communicate effectively with business and cross functional/technical partners.
  • Active participation and contribution to PI, product & release planning etc.
  • Collaborate with onsite and offsite team members effectively.


Core Skills:

  • 9+ years in Java J2EE building web applications, spring technologies/frameworks (Spring Core, Spring MVC, Spring Cloud, Spring Boot) and tools.
  • Java, JEE & spring technologies/frameworks (Spring Core, Spring MVC, Spring Cloud, Spring Boot) and tools.
  • 5+ years of experience with related frameworks and technologies (Hibernate, Restful services Spring JDBC, MVC etc.)
  • Strong experience with Microservices, Spring Boot / Spring framework, Rest API, JPA.
  • 8+ years of experience in web development using HTML, CSS and JavaScript including ES2016+
  • Minimum 2 years of experience of REACT tools including React.js, Webpack, Redux and Flux
  • Experience with user interface design
  • Knowledge of unit testing frameworks like Mocha and Jest
  • Experience with browser based debugging and excellent troubleshooting skills
  • Knowledge on system architecture (N-Tire, Microservices, Cloud-native).
  • Strong knowledge of system design principles for scalable, high-performance, and extensible solutions for enterprise grade distributed and services systems.
  • Significant knowledge of Oracle PL/SQL and SQL.
  • Experience with Oracle Web logic, Tomcat to include installation, configuration, troubleshooting.
  • Working experience of Spring Boot application configuration, deployment and troubleshooting on server platforms Oracle Web logic/Tomcat/Cloud.
  • Experience with API management and Cloud-based platforms and services (AWS, Google).
  • Working knowledge of Dev-Ops: Git, Jenkins, CI/CD pipelines, etc.
  • Understanding of Test-Driven Development practices as well as Automation and Unit Testing.
  • Strong Analytical Skills.
  • Working knowledge on system observability/monitoring and alerting.
  • Experience Architecting and developing large scale Enterprise applications.
  • Proficient with software development lifecycle (SDLC) methodologies like Agile, Test- driven development.
  • Any experience in building applications for financial industry is a plus


Education:

  • Bachelor’s or higher degree in Computer Science, Engineering, or a related field.
  • Proven experience (12+years) in Engineering role.
  • 3+ Years experience as Engineering/Technical lead role.
  • Excellent communication skills and the ability to collaborate effectively with cross-functional teams.
  • Demonstrated experience in delivering complex enterprise grade software solutions.


Why Ness


We know that people are our greatest asset. Our staff’s professionalism, innovation, teamwork, and dedication to excellence have helped us become one of the world’s leading technology companies. It is these qualities that are vital to our continued success. As a Ness employee, you will be working on products and platforms for some of the most innovative software companies in the world.


We offer our employees exciting and challenging projects across a diverse range of industries, as well as the opportunity to collaborate with a group of forward-thinking, capable partners around the globe.



  • Princeton, New Jersey, United States Diverse Lynx Full time

    Job Title: Fullstack Java DeveloperJob Summary:We are seeking a highly skilled Fullstack Java Developer to join our team at Diverse Lynx LLC. As a Fullstack Java Developer, you will be responsible for designing, developing, and deploying scalable and efficient software systems using Java and related technologies.Key Responsibilities:• Design and develop...


  • Princeton, New Jersey, United States Diverse Lynx Full time

    Fullstack Java DeveloperWe are seeking a highly skilled Fullstack Java Developer to join our team at Diverse Lynx LLC. As a Fullstack Java Developer, you will be responsible for designing, developing, and deploying scalable and efficient software applications using Java and React.js.Key Responsibilities:Design and develop fullstack applications using Java...


  • Princeton, New Jersey, United States Diverse Lynx Full time

    Job Title: Fullstack Java Developer with Microservices ExperienceRole Overview: We are seeking a highly skilled Fullstack Java Developer to join our team at Diverse Lynx LLC. As a Fullstack Java Developer, you will be responsible for designing, developing, and deploying scalable and efficient software systems using Java and related technologies.Key...

  • Fullstack Java

    3 weeks ago


    Princeton, United States Diverse Lynx Full time

    R ole name: Developer Role Description: Full Stack Java Developer with ReactJS and SQL Skills Competencies: Digital : ReactJS, Advanced Java Concepts, PL/SQL Experience (Years): 10 & Above Essential Skills: Full Stack Java Developer with ReactJS and SQL Skills Desirable Skills: Full Stack Java Developer with ReactJS and SQL Skills Country: ...


  • Princeton, New Jersey, United States Sage IT Inc Full time

    Job OverviewSage IT Inc is seeking a highly skilled Fulltime Java Fullstack Developer with React Experience to join our team.Key ResponsibilitiesDesign and develop robust Java applications with React frontends.Collaborate with cross-functional teams to deliver high-quality software solutions.Stay up-to-date with the latest Java and React technologies to...


  • Princeton, New Jersey, United States Sage IT Inc Full time

    Job OpportunitySage IT Inc is seeking a highly skilled Fulltime Java Fullstack Developer with React Experience to join our team.Key Responsibilities:Design and develop robust Java applications with React front-end.Collaborate with cross-functional teams to deliver high-quality software solutions.Stay up-to-date with industry trends and best practices in Java...


  • Princeton, New Jersey, United States Diverse Lynx Full time

    Job Summary: We are seeking a highly skilled Java Fullstack Developer to join our team at Diverse Lynx LLC.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ex software systems using Java 8 and above features. Key Responsibilities: Design and develop high-quality software systems using Java 8...

  • Lead Java

    3 weeks ago


    Princeton, United States Cosmic-I LLC DBA Northern Base Full time

    Title: Java Lead/ ArchitectLocation: Princeton, NJPosition Type: FTE Job Description:12 years of experience Technical lead or ArchitectDefine/detailing architecture/design for different data patternsSemantic modelling and experience in Web3.0 technologies, Java 17Knowledge on frameworks such as , RDF, OWL, Shacl, graphDB, sparql is preferableDefine scope...

  • Java FullStack Lead

    3 weeks ago


    Princeton, United States Ness Digital Engineering Full time

    Ness is a full lifecycle digital engineering firm offering digital advisory through scaled engineering services. Combining our core competence in engineering with the latest in digital strategy and technology, we seamlessly manage Digital Transformation journeys from strategy through execution to help businesses thrive in the digital economy. As your tech...


  • Princeton, New Jersey, United States Bright Vision Technologies Full time

    Job Title: Senior Lead Java DeveloperBright Vision Technologies is seeking a highly skilled Senior Lead Java Developer to join our team in Princeton, NJ.As a Senior Lead Java Developer, you will be responsible for leading the development of complex Java-based applications, working closely with cross-functional teams to design and implement scalable,...


  • Princeton, New Jersey, United States Bright Vision Technologies Full time

    Job DescriptionBright Vision Technologies is seeking a Senior Lead Java Developer to join our team based out of Princeton, NJ.As a Senior Lead Java Developer, you will be responsible for leading the development of web applications using Java, J2EE, and Spring technologies.Key Responsibilities:Lead the development of web applications using Java, J2EE, and...

  • Developer

    1 month ago


    Princeton, United States Appirio Full time

    Wipro Limited (NYSE: WIT, BSE: 507685, NSE: WIPRO) is a leading technology services and consulting company focused on building innovative solutions that address clients’ most complex digital transformation needs. We leverage our holistic portfolio of capabilities in consulting, design, engineering, operations, and emerging technologies to help clients...


  • Princeton, New Jersey, United States Bright Vision Technologies Full time

    Job Title: Senior Lead Java DeveloperJob Summary:Bright Vision Technologies is seeking a highly experienced Senior Lead Java Developer to join our team in Princeton, NJ. As a key member of our development team, you will be responsible for designing, developing, and implementing complex software systems using Java and related technologies.Key...


  • Princeton, New Jersey, United States Ness Digital Engineering Full time

    Job Title: Java Full Stack LeadJob Summary:Ness Digital Engineering is seeking a highly skilled Java Full Stack Lead to join our team. As a Java Full Stack Lead, you will be responsible for leading a talented team of engineers in the development of complex business requirements. You will demonstrate high technical acumen, solution design capability, and...


  • Princeton, New Jersey, United States Diverse Lynx Full time

    Job Title: Java Technical ArchitectLocation: RemoteJob Type: ContractJob Description:We are seeking a highly skilled Java Technical Architect to join our team at Diverse Lynx LLC. As a key member of our technology team, you will be responsible for designing and implementing scalable, secure, and efficient solutions using Java and related technologies.Key...


  • Princeton, New Jersey, United States Diverse Lynx Full time

    Job Title: Java Technical ArchitectLocation: RemoteJob Type: ContractKey Responsibilities:Design and implement scalable Java-based solutionsDevelop and maintain high-quality code using Spring and Spring BootCollaborate with cross-functional teams to deliver projects on time and within budgetStay up-to-date with industry trends and emerging technologiesAbout...

  • Java Technical Lead

    2 weeks ago


    Princeton Junction, New Jersey, United States Diverse Lynx Full time

    Job Title: Java Technical ArchitectWe are seeking a highly skilled Java Technical Architect to join our team at Diverse Lynx LLC.About the Role:This is a contract position that involves solution designing using Java, C, C++, Spring, Springboot, API Design, and Restful web services.The ideal candidate will have experience with microservices, design patterns,...

  • Lead Java Developer

    2 weeks ago


    Princeton, United States TalentOla Full time

    Strong Java and Micro services development experienceExpertise in Azure, Cloud or Kubernetes, Docker and Open ShiftPrevious work experience with Spring frameworkStrong technical development experience on effectively writing code, code reviews, best practices code refactoring A delivery focused approach to work and the ability to work without direction...

  • Senior Java Architect

    2 weeks ago


    Princeton, New Jersey, United States Diamondpick Full time

    Job SummaryAt Diamondpick, we're seeking a highly skilled Senior Java Architect to lead our technical team in designing and implementing cutting-edge Java solutions. As a key member of our architecture team, you will be responsible for defining and detailing architecture/design for different data patterns, semantic modeling, and experience in Web3.0...


  • Princeton, New Jersey, United States Diamondpick Full time

    Key Responsibilities:As a Senior Java FSD Developer at Diamondpick, you will be responsible for developing and maintaining Java FSD applications. Your expertise in Java FSD development, automation, and documentation will be crucial in driving the success of our projects. You will work closely with our QA team to ensure seamless test execution and...